PhysX Driver that Works on all Capable GPUs to be out by August
Reports by TG Daily suggest that NVIDIA could release a WHQL-certified stable release PhysX driver that supports all capable GPUs GeForce 8 series thru 9-series and GTX 200 series. The driver would expand driver-level support to all PhysX-based game titles including the likes of Ghost Recon 2: Advanced Warfighter, Warmonger and Cell Factor: Revolution.
It is expected that downloads of free games such as Warmonger and Cell Factor could spike in August since the user-base of PhysX substantially increase then. The driver is expected to be out on the 5th of August. Source: TG Daily |
